Why We Use Prayer as Part of Our Business Strategy at 4Soca Inc.



Image created using DALL-E, a generative AI model by OpenAI, July 2024



At 4Soca Inc., our mission is not just to excel in business but also to create a lasting, positive impact on society. A significant part of our strategy involves integrating prayer into our daily operations. We believe that prayer helps us align our actions with divine guidance, ensuring that our business practices reflect our values of integrity, compassion, and sustainability. Here are some Bible verses that inspire and guide us in making prayer a foundational aspect of our business strategy.


1. Seeking Wisdom and Guidance

“If any of you lacks wisdom, let him ask of God, who gives to all liberally and without reproach, and it will be given to him.” - James 1:5

In the fast-paced world of business, we often face complex decisions. Prayer helps us seek divine wisdom, ensuring that our choices are not just beneficial for our company but also ethically sound and aligned with our mission. By turning to God for guidance, we navigate challenges with confidence and clarity.


2. Fostering a Spirit of Integrity

“Whatever you do, work at it with all your heart, as working for the Lord, not for human masters.” - Colossians 3:23

Prayer reminds us to work with integrity and dedication. At 4Soca Inc., we strive to conduct our business as though we are working directly for God. This perspective encourages us to maintain high ethical standards, treat everyone with respect, and deliver our best in all we do.

3. Building a Supportive Community

“For where two or three gather in my name, there am I with them.” - Matthew 18:20

Prayer brings our team together, fostering a sense of unity and community. It helps us create a supportive and nurturing work environment where everyone feels valued and connected. This unity enhances collaboration, reduces conflicts, and promotes a harmonious workplace.

4. Inspiring Innovation and Creativity

“But as it is written: ‘Eye has not seen, nor ear heard, nor have entered into the heart of man the things which God has prepared for those who love Him.’” - 1 Corinthians 2:9

Prayer opens our hearts and minds to divine inspiration, sparking innovative ideas and creative solutions. By seeking God’s vision for our company, we are able to pioneer new approaches to sustainability, media, and community engagement, leading to transformative impacts.


5. Promoting Sustainability

“The earth is the Lord’s, and everything in it, the world, and all who live in it.” - Psalm 24:1

Our commitment to sustainability is rooted in the belief that we are stewards of God’s creation. Prayer reinforces this responsibility, motivating us to adopt practices that protect and preserve the environment. This spiritual foundation is evident in our green initiatives and our dedication to achieving Net Zero goals.


6. Encouraging Employee Well-being

“Come to me, all you who are weary and burdened, and I will give you rest.” - Matthew 11:28

The inclusion of prayer in our business strategy contributes to the overall well-being of our employees. It provides them with a sense of peace and purpose, reducing stress and promoting mental and emotional health. We encourage our team members to take time for reflection and spiritual growth, which enhances their productivity and job satisfaction.

7. Driving Social Change

“Defend the weak and the fatherless; uphold the cause of the poor and the oppressed.” - Psalm 82:3

Prayer fuels our passion for social justice and inspires us to advocate for change. We are committed to using our platform to address pressing social issues such as poverty, inequality, and human rights. Our faith-driven initiatives aim to create a more equitable and compassionate world.


8. Building Trust and Loyalty

“Trust in the Lord with all your heart and lean not on your own understanding; in all your ways submit to him, and he will make your paths straight.” - Proverbs 3:5-6

Consumers and partners trust companies that operate with a higher purpose. By integrating prayer into our business model, we demonstrate our commitment to values that resonate with our audience. This approach builds brand loyalty and strengthens our reputation as a company that prioritizes ethical and spiritual principles.

Conclusion

At 4Soca Inc., we believe that incorporating prayer into our business strategy is essential for achieving our goals and fulfilling our mission. It enhances our ethical practices, fosters a positive work environment, inspires innovation, and strengthens our community bonds. By promoting sustainability, employee well-being, and social change, we aim to create a better world. Through prayer, we find the guidance and inspiration to pursue our vision with compassion, integrity, and purpose.

We hope our approach inspires other organizations to explore the profound impact that spirituality can have on their operations and the broader community. Together, we can build a future where businesses not only thrive but also contribute to the greater good.
